Some development has been continuing with xdvi(k) after the TL code freeze.
You might want to consider adding those changes to the Debian version.
For the most current version, grab the copy in CVS (on sourceforge), not the
latest numbered release.

Recent changes include:

  o  Added support for XkbBell (so that the bell works again with newer servers)

  o  Fixed bugs in the handling of 32-bit window properties (for source specials)
     on 64-bit platforms.
